Pellet Stoves

 Pellet stoves provide consumers with a convenient, clean burning, efficient heating solution. They burn pellet fuel which is comprised of wood by-products and sawdust from lumber mills. The material is dried, compressed and formed into small 1/4" diameter cylinders. They are then packaged in 40 pound, water-proof bags for easy handling and storage. Some models of pellet stoves offer automatic operation from a wall thermostat while others use stove-mounted controls. Many have large hoppers for longer burn times - up to 40 hours! Pellet stoves require electricity to operate. As a result, many stove manufacturers offer battery back-up options in case of power failure. Pellet appliances can be installed virtually anywhere in your home due to their minimum clearance requirements and venting capabilities.
